Turn years of memories into personal doodles
Joodle is a creative iOS app designed for users who want to transform everyday moments into a visual diary through simple doodles. Geared towards those who enjoy journaling, reflecting, or capturing memories in a fun, accessible way, Joodle allows users to draw quick sketches that represent their thoughts, feelings, or notable events. Its intuitive interface requires no artistic skills, making it suitable for anyone interested in personal expression and mindfulness. With features like daily prompts, countdowns to important dates, and living timelines, Joodle encourages consistent engagement, helping users build a meaningful visual record of their lives. The app’s seamless iCloud sync ensures that memories are preserved and accessible across all devices, adding to its convenience and appeal.

Translate text in your videos without recreating visuals
Visual Translate by Vozo is a groundbreaking SaaS tool designed to simplify the process of creating multilingual videos by translating on-screen text without the need to recreate visuals. It seamlessly detects and translates text embedded within videos—such as slides, callouts, labels, and diagrams—while maintaining the original layout, style, and animations. This makes it an ideal solution for content creators, educators, marketers, and businesses aiming to reach a global audience without the time-consuming process of re-editing videos from scratch. By integrating voice dubbing, lip-sync, and subtitle translation, Visual Translate offers a comprehensive approach to multilingual video localization, saving users significant time and effort while expanding their reach.
